個(gè)人簡(jiǎn)介

李傳順 博士、研究員、博士生導(dǎo)師,自然資源部第一海洋研究所海洋地質(zhì)與地球物理研究室副主任,山東省深海礦產(chǎn)資源開發(fā)重點(diǎn)實(shí)驗(yàn)室(籌)副主任,海洋一所“海底成礦作用與資源評(píng)價(jià)”團(tuán)隊(duì)負(fù)責(zé)人,山東省新一輪找礦突破戰(zhàn)略行動(dòng)專家指導(dǎo)組成員。近十年來主要從事深海礦產(chǎn)資源勘探、評(píng)價(jià)與開發(fā)研究?!笆濉币詠肀恢袊笱笫聞?wù)管理局聘為資源勘查領(lǐng)域首席科學(xué)家,并擔(dān)任“多金屬硫化物資源勘查-大西洋靶區(qū)”項(xiàng)目首席科學(xué)家,帶領(lǐng)團(tuán)隊(duì)系統(tǒng)開展了大西洋海底多金屬硫化物成礦作用研究,在南大西洋中脊圈定出15個(gè)找礦遠(yuǎn)景區(qū),并鎖定10余處礦化區(qū),包括1處潛在資源量達(dá)千萬噸級(jí)的富銅型海底多金屬硫化物大型礦化區(qū),為我國深海資源勘查在三大洋的戰(zhàn)略布局提供了支撐。近三年發(fā)表海底成礦作用與資源評(píng)價(jià)方向相關(guān)論文20余篇,以第一發(fā)明人獲得發(fā)明專利授權(quán)20項(xiàng)。
